Germany – Government says companies reporting greater difficulty when hiring IT talent

05 December 2019

Companies in Germany are having more difficulty filling IT vacancies, Germany’s Federal Statistical Office reported Thursday.

Looking at data from 2018, the agency said that 69% of firms hiring, or trying to hire IT talent, reported difficulties in hiring IT experts — that’s up from 64% in 2017 and 46% in 2014.

Meanwhile, the percentage of firms hiring, or trying to hire, IT talent remained constant at around 10% of companies.

Problems companies ran into while trying to hire IT talent included lack of applicants, candidates without necessary skills or job experience, and those who had salary expectations that were too high.
